CVE-2019-14122 : Vulnerability Insights and Analysis

Learn about CVE-2019-14122, a vulnerability in Snapdragon Auto and Snapdragon Mobile platforms leading to memory failure in SKB due to inadequate padding allocation, impacting Saipan, SM8150, SM8250, SXR2130 devices.

In Snapdragon Auto and Snapdragon Mobile platforms, a vulnerability exists that can lead to memory failure in SKB due to inadequate padding allocation in low-memory or heavily fragmented memory targets.

Understanding CVE-2019-14122

This CVE involves a memory allocation issue in specific Qualcomm devices, potentially resulting in memory failure.

What is CVE-2019-14122?

The vulnerability in Snapdragon Auto and Snapdragon Mobile platforms can cause memory failure in SKB due to insufficient padding allocation in certain device types.

The Impact of CVE-2019-14122

The vulnerability may lead to memory failure in SKB, affecting the performance and stability of the affected devices.

Technical Details of CVE-2019-14122

The technical aspects of this CVE include:

Vulnerability Description

        Memory allocation process fails to include necessary padding in the skb
        Primarily affects low-memory targets or devices with significant memory fragmentation

Affected Systems and Versions

        Products: Snapdragon Auto, Snapdragon Mobile
        Versions: Saipan, SM8150, SM8250, SXR2130

Exploitation Mechanism

        Memory failure occurs due to the absence of required padding in the skb
